The switching power chip market is an essential segment of the broader semiconductor industry, which has seen increasing demand across various applications. Switching power chips, also known as switch-mode power supplies (SMPS), are critical for efficient power conversion in numerous sectors, enabling better energy management and reduced waste. These chips allow for the transformation of input power into a more usable output, all while minimizing losses. As industries continue to evolve and grow, the need for efficient, cost-effective, and compact power management solutions drives significant innovations in switching power chips. The automotive industry is one of the fastest-growing segments for switching power chips. These chips are widely used in electric vehicles (EVs), hybrid vehicles, and autonomous driving systems, where energy efficiency is paramount. In electric vehicles, for example, switching power chips are crucial for managing battery power, ensuring that power conversion processes are as efficient as possible to maximize vehicle range and performance. Additionally, as automotive technologies advance toward more sophisticated systems, such as infotainment, navigation, and safety features, the demand for highly efficient power supplies within these systems is on the rise. Switching power chips help minimize power consumption and improve the overall energy management of these systems, making them an indispensable component of modern vehicles.
Furthermore, the automotive sector is increasingly incorporating electric and hybrid vehicles, which are designed to reduce environmental impact while maintaining high-performance standards. Switching power chips in these applications ensure that power is delivered in a controlled and efficient manner, which is critical to the smooth operation of advanced automotive features. In the context of electric and hybrid vehicles, these chips help optimize battery life, charging systems, and even regenerative braking technologies, further enhancing the overall user experience. With the growing focus on sustainability, switching power chips are expected to play a more prominent role in the evolution of next-generation vehicles, contributing significantly to the development of cleaner, more energy-efficient transportation systems.
In the industrial sector, switching power chips play a vital role in the operation of a wide range of machinery, equipment, and control systems. These chips are used in power supplies for industrial automation, robotics, and power distribution systems, where high efficiency and reliability are essential for maintaining smooth operations. Power management solutions using switching power chips enable manufacturers to optimize the performance of their machinery while minimizing energy loss and reducing the risk of downtime. As industries continue to automate and incorporate more advanced technologies like AI and IoT, the demand for efficient power management solutions, including switching power chips, is expected to rise significantly in industrial applications.
Switching power chips also facilitate energy efficiency in industrial settings by enabling more reliable and precise control over power distribution. This is especially important in environments where machinery operates 24/7, such as factories and large-scale manufacturing facilities. These chips help ensure that power is supplied in a consistent and controlled manner, reducing the risk of power surges or interruptions that could lead to equipment failure or costly repairs. With the increasing push for sustainability and energy-saving technologies in the industrial sector, switching power chips will continue to be a key enabler of more efficient and environmentally friendly industrial operations.
The medical industry represents a significant application for switching power chips, particularly in devices requiring highly reliable and efficient power management. Medical equipment such as imaging devices, diagnostic systems, and patient monitoring tools all rely on switching power chips to ensure that they function with the utmost precision and reliability. Power supplies in these devices must be stable, regulated, and efficient, as any fluctuation could potentially affect the accuracy of medical readings or even compromise patient safety. Switching power chips help ensure that the power is delivered consistently, contributing to the overall safety and reliability of medical systems.
As medical devices become increasingly sophisticated and portable, the demand for compact and energy-efficient power solutions continues to rise. Wearable health devices, portable diagnostic tools, and home-care systems are just some examples of emerging medical applications that depend on switching power chips. These chips are designed to deliver optimal power conversion while minimizing heat generation and ensuring long-lasting performance. Furthermore, the trend toward more personalized healthcare and remote patient monitoring is likely to further expand the market for switching power chips in the medical industry, making these components a key enabler of next-generation medical technology.
In the communication sector, switching power chips are integral to the power supply systems of a variety of devices, including routers, base stations, mobile phones, and telecommunications infrastructure. With the continuous expansion of the global communication networks, especially with the rise of 5G technology, the need for efficient power management solutions has grown exponentially. Switching power chips help telecommunications equipment achieve stable power delivery while maintaining energy efficiency, which is crucial for supporting the increasing demand for high-speed data and connectivity. These chips are also essential in reducing the size and weight of communication devices, enabling more compact designs for portable equipment.
The importance of switching power chips in communication systems is heightened as networks become more complex and data-intensive. Power management in 5G base stations, for instance, requires highly efficient chips that can handle large volumes of data while maintaining low power consumption. With the continuous development of communication infrastructure, including satellite communication systems and the deployment of IoT devices, switching power chips will continue to play a key role in powering these advanced technologies. The shift toward higher bandwidth, faster data speeds, and more reliable communication will drive ongoing innovation in power chip design, ensuring these devices remain at the forefront of modern communication systems.

One of the key trends in the switching power chip market is the increasing demand for energy-efficient solutions across all sectors. With growing concerns about energy consumption and environmental sustainability, industries are seeking to reduce their carbon footprints and minimize energy waste. As a result, switching power chips that offer higher conversion efficiency and lower energy loss are in high demand. Technological advancements in semiconductor materials, such as the development of wide-bandgap (WBG) semiconductors like gallium nitride (GaN) and silicon carbide (SiC), are making it possible to create chips that are even more efficient than traditional silicon-based chips, driving the market's growth in energy-conscious industries.
Another significant trend is the rapid growth of the electric vehicle market, which is driving the demand for switching power chips. As the automotive industry embraces electrification, the need for efficient power conversion in electric drivetrains, charging systems, and battery management systems is more critical than ever. Switching power chips play an integral role in optimizing these systems, enabling better performance and longer battery life. This trend is not limited to passenger vehicles, as the commercial vehicle market is also investing heavily in electric technology. The automotive industry's shift towards EVs is expected to further accelerate the adoption of switching power chips, particularly in the context of next-generation electric vehicle designs.
The growing demand for renewable energy solutions presents a significant opportunity for the switching power chip market. Solar power systems, wind energy systems, and energy storage solutions all require efficient power conversion, and switching power chips are essential in these applications. As countries and businesses look to reduce their reliance on fossil fuels, the need for sustainable energy solutions will increase, driving demand for the semiconductor technologies that enable these systems. Switching power chips will be key enablers of the clean energy transition, providing efficient and reliable power management for renewable energy systems and smart grid technologies.
Additionally, the rising demand for IoT devices presents an exciting opportunity for switching power chip manufacturers. IoT devices are designed to be low-power, highly efficient, and compact, making switching power chips an ideal solution for powering these devices. From smart home appliances to industrial sensors and wearable health monitors, the growing adoption of IoT technologies is driving the need for power management solutions that can handle the unique challenges of these applications. With the proliferation of connected devices across various industries, switching power chips will continue to be a crucial component in the development of the next generation of IoT systems.
